Output f6ec1dcc2471a81fbc1e2cfd27b5cf8b0d4b12a856835604ed804307ed091e57:2

value
27015487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a80f2b9c149773960e0fb8baf2afbf8f09a9c34 OP_EQUAL
address
3EKMeVQrvJZExg5FzanP48FjqBEx6Dhpm5
transaction
f6ec1dcc2471a81fbc1e2cfd27b5cf8b0d4b12a856835604ed804307ed091e57
spent
true